Transaction 500ccb2fe46f48fda347467ecef9afb7962fa31f2bdfecb3a9628ea7ad08fc44

3 Input
1 Outputs
  • 500ccb2fe46f48fda347467ecef9afb7962fa31f2bdfecb3a9628ea7ad08fc44:0
  • value  3704286
    address  32VMwPi8WRruEowYayTg1hNmJSKgGknzoG